密码翻译

题目背景

$\text{Update on 2023.01.21 11:33:00}$:目前数据已经修复,对于题解中提到的 `@` 应视作 `A` 的问题经调查发现为一个错误,现在已经修复。

题目描述

在情报传递过程中,为了防止情报被截获,往往需要对情报用一定的方式加密。我们给出一种最简单的加密方法,对给定的一个字符串,把其中从 $\texttt{a} \sim \texttt{y}$,$\texttt{A} \sim \texttt{Y}$ 的字母用其后继字母替代,把 $\texttt{z}$ 和 $\texttt{Z}$ 用 $\texttt{a}$ 和 $\texttt{A}$ 替代,其他非字母字符不变。请根据该加密规则将输入的密码进行解密。 提示:这里需要进行**解密**操作,而不是**加密**。

输入输出格式

输入格式


一行,加密后的字符串,长度不多于 $10000$ 个字符。

输出格式


一行,将密码解密后的字符串。

输入输出样例

输入样例 #1

Ifmmp !  Ipx  bsf  zpv!

输出样例 #1

Hello !  How  are  you!

说明

感谢 @[Hughpig](https://www.luogu.com.cn/user/646208) 提供本题数据。